Study of Vibration and Noise Performance of Steel Fiber-Free Frictional Material
By means of theoretieal analysis and modal experiment combined with research of material, the inherent frequency and damping coefficient will be studied for the steel fiber-free frictional pad that is reinforced by mixture and made by the authors. The effects of material Ingredients and percentages on dynamic properties of material will be investigated. The conclusion is that the steel fiber-free frictional pad reinforced by mixture has better performance of reducing vibration and lowering noise. The results will be guidable to the further design and research of steel fiber-free frictional material with less vibration and low noise.
